Monitoring Vaccine Availability

 

Submitted by Anna Lyle

As you are aware, multiple vaccines for COVID-19 have been distributed and administered over the last three weeks.  I encourage you to get a vaccine once it is available to you.  Because of the phased distribution of the vaccine, we will be eligible at different times depending on our age, health status, and county of residence. 

Forsyth County residents who are 65+ will be eligible for a vaccine beginning January 11th.  Information released this afternoon by Forsyth County Government recommends that residents monitor the District 2 Public Health website.  As of Tuesday evening, registrations are available for healthcare workers only, but this should change soon.  Hall, Dawson, and Lumpkin counties are also in District 2.  If you reside in a different county, you can find your health district here.  Districts have different ways of handling registrations.  For example, one allows residents to pre-register to be contacted once they are eligible.  Another only allows registrations for specific groups and only when vaccines are on hand (in other words, no appointments available).

Despite the differences between districts, it’s my understanding from Chris Grimes (Director of Forsyth County Emergency Management Agency) that all districts must distribute the vaccines in the order determined by the Georgia Department of Public Health (DPH).  Julie Walker with Georgia Public Library Service is in contact with DPH and the Association of County Commissioners of Georgia to advocate for library workers to be included with essential workers and/or educational staff. 

I will continue to be in touch with Chris Grimes about options for FCPL staff to receive vaccinations.  Even if we are included with essential workers and/or educational staff, that timeline is not currently known. 

We will continue to pursue options at the state and local level, but there is no guarantee of a priority designation for library staff.  So, I encourage you to take advantage of any opportunity you have to receive the vaccine.
